Sterility indicators are applied to examine the standard and checking of sterilization processes. They're able to show regardless of whether microbial advancement happens or sterilization was helpful. There are lots of kinds of sterility indicators for different sterilization methods together with dry warmth, moist heat, gaseous, radiation, and filtration sterilization.

Sterility could be defined as the liberty through the presence of feasible microorganisms. However, the situations that guarantee absolute sterility are often as well severe for Energetic ingredients, as well as the definition of sterility for any medicinal item should be defined in purposeful phrases.
